Coasteering in Newquay
Nestled along the rugged Cornish coastline, Newquay is a renowned hub for coasteering, an exhilarating activity that combines swimming, climbing, and cliff jumping.
Coasteering enthusiasts can explore sea caves, navigate through tunnels, and plunge into crystal-clear waters. Led by experienced instructors, the two-hour coasteering tours accommodate small groups of up to eight participants.
Adventurers will learn essential techniques for safe traversing and wild swimming, while keeping an eye out for diverse marine life.
With comprehensive safety briefings and high-quality equipment provided, coasteering in Newquay offers an adrenaline-fueled experience amidst the region’s dramatic natural landscapes.

What’s Included
The coasteering experience comes with a comprehensive package of inclusions to ensure participants’ comfort and safety. Beginner and seasoned adventurers alike will be outfitted with industry-leading gear, including wetsuits, buoyancy aids, and helmets. Secure storage is provided for valuables in lock boxes, and heated changing rooms, hot showers, and restrooms are available. Experienced coasteer instructors provide a full safety briefing and teach essential techniques. Participants also enjoy discounts on additional activities, local establishments, and the Rip Curl store. For guests’ convenience, a dog sitter can be arranged upon request.

Safety and Accessibility
Comprehensive safety briefings are provided to all participants before the coasteering adventure begins.
The activity is designed to be a no-pressure environment, allowing visitors to skip sections or jumps as needed.
However, coasteering isn’t suitable for individuals with mobility impairments or children under 8 years old.

Can I Bring My Own Snacks and Drinks?
Yes, participants can bring their own snacks and drinks. However, the activity provider recommends limiting personal items for comfort and safety during the coasteering adventure.
Is There a Minimum Age Requirement?
The activity has a minimum age requirement of 8 years old. Children under 8 are not permitted to participate due to safety concerns. Participants must be able to follow instructions and navigate the coasteering course safely.
Are There Any Dietary Restrictions Accommodated?
The activity does not explicitly state if dietary restrictions are accommodated. However, given the nature of the experience, it’s best to inquire about any dietary needs when making the booking to ensure the provider can make necessary arrangements.
What Types of Marine Wildlife Can We Expect to See?
Participants can expect to see a variety of marine wildlife along the coasteering route, including seabirds, crabs, small fish, and potential sightings of seals. The experienced instructors will point out any notable species encountered during the adventure.
Do I Need to Be an Experienced Swimmer to Participate?
No, you don’t need to be an experienced swimmer. The coasteering activity is suitable for beginners as well. The instructors provide thorough safety briefings and techniques to help participants feel comfortable in the water, regardless of their swimming ability.
